New NPE Sues Violin Memory over Flash Arrays

January 6, 2012

Narada Systems [NPE] filed suit against Violin Memory, alleging that Violin’s flash memory arrays infringe two patents related to switch fabrics that include asymmetrical and multiport switching elements.  This is the first patent infringement suit initiated by Narada Systems.  Gautam Kavipurapu is the named inventor on the patents-in-suit as well as a director of Iris Technologies (later named Iris Holdings), which assigned the patents to Narada in November 2011. According to the complaint, ”NARADA was formed in 2009 for the purpose of commercializing the technology protected by the ‘786 Patent, and is currently based in the Eastern District of Texas. NARADA is managed by Richard Burnes, who is also a long time resident of Allen Texas.”
